#296c4f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#296c4f is composed of 16.1% red, 42.4% green and 31%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 62% cyan, 0% magenta, 26.9% yellow and 57.6% black. It has a hue angle of 154 degrees, a saturation of 45% and a lightness of 29.2%. #296c4f color hex could be obtained by blending #52d89e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336666.

#296c4f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#296c4f has RGB values of R:41, G:108, B:79 and CMYK values of C:0.62, M:0, Y:0.27, K:0.58. Its decimal value is 2714703.

Shades and Tints of #296c4f
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030806 is the darkest color, while #f9fdfb is the lightest one.
